The newly formed ‘Advanced NPD’ team sits at the heart of Dyson’s product development machine, pioneering new concepts in NPD (New Product Development) as well as maturing concepts/technologies from upstream teams into more mature product offerings.

Detailed Job Scope (Roles & Responsibilities)
Actively contribute to innovation and concept generation. Help to Identify unmet needs and business opportunities, then propose and pitch innovative new product concepts or technologies.
Lead projects by running regular sprint meetings, involving relevant team members, setting actions, and maintaining/updating timelines and objectives.
Set and manage technical budgets and high-level requirements (e.g. pressure, power, flow, performance targets), optimising them to ensure performance / claims targets are met.
Select and specify key components and architecture balancing performance, cost, and manufacturability.
Collaborate with upstream technology teams, external suppliers, and internal electronics, design, and software teams to mature and transition technologies to delivery-ready status.
Work hands-on to rapidly prototype concepts, test feasibility, and iterate designs. embracing a fail-fast mentality.
Present ideas, concepts, and design decisions clearly to internal teams and stakeholders, confidently selling the vision and solutions.
React quickly to evolving project requirements, reprioritising tasks and resources to maintain momentum.
Foster innovation by critiquing previous solutions and suggesting smarter, more effective alternatives.
